What is another word for isotropize?

Pronunciation: [ˈa͡ɪsətɹˌɒpa͡ɪz] (IPA)

Isotropize refers to the process of making something isotropic, which means having the same physical properties in all directions. Synonyms for isotropize include homogenize, equalize, normalize, and standardize. Homogenize implies making something uniform throughout, while equalize suggests making something equal in value or quantity. Normalize implies bringing something to the norm or standard, while standardize suggests conforming to an established standard. Other synonyms for isotropize include regularize, even out, and level out. Whether it's in the field of physics or materials science, isotropizing plays a crucial role in achieving symmetry and balance of materials or objects.
